The Grass Surface at Wimbledon

Specific Grass Type (Perennial Rye Grass)

Wimbledon\’s courts primarily consist of perennial ryegrass, a fine-bladed, cool-season grass. This particular grass variety is favoured for its durability, ability to recuperate quickly, and its capacity to provide a consistent and fast playing surface.

Reasons for Grass Selection

The choice of perennial ryegrass aligns with Wimbledon\’s commitment to providing a unique playing experience. Its dense and resilient nature ensures a reliable and consistent surface, enhancing the challenges and strategies involved in playing on grass courts.

Suitability for Tennis and Player Preferences

Perennial rye grass\’s low, dense growth habit minimizes ball bounce, resulting in a faster-paced game. This characteristic, combined with its lush green appearance, makes it the preferred surface for many players, adding an element of unpredictability and excitement to the matches.

Mowing and Maintenance Practices

Frequency and Technique of Mowing for Grass Courts

The grass at Wimbledon is mowed to an exact height of 8 millimetres, a length carefully chosen to ensure a balance between speed, ball bounce, and durability. The precise mowing schedule is strictly adhered to, contributing to the consistent and high-performance playing surface.

Fertilization, Irrigation, and Soil Management

Methods and Schedule for Fertilization

The application of specialized fertilizers tailored to the needs of perennial ryegrass is meticulously timed and executed to promote healthy growth, vigour, and recovery, ensuring the grass remains lush and resilient throughout the tournament.

Irrigation Systems and Water Management

Advanced irrigation systems are employed to deliver precise and consistent moisture levels, vital for sustaining the grass\’s health and playability. The efficient and strategic use of water resources is an essential aspect of the court maintenance process.

Soil Testing and Enhancement for Grass Health and Resilience

Regular soil testing is conducted to assess nutrient levels and soil composition, guiding the application of targeted enhancements to maintain optimal soil health. This proactive approach fortifies the grass against stressors and sustains its vigour.
